ServiceNow Administrator
An opportunity to join a small team with a global remit for enterprise applications in a fast growing mid-sized business. Based in Glasgow you'll need to be in the office 2-3 days a week.
The job is platform ownership and administration across a suite of enterprise applications - primarily ServiceNow, but also including Dynamics 365 CRM, Microsoft Azure and Intune. You will manage configuration, oversee releases and patches, handle escalations beyond first-line support, and maintain the documentation, automation and training to reduce repeat queries. You will own a small portfolio of applications and will take functional responsibility for configuration and changes.
You'll need a background as a systems administrator, and particular experience with ServiceNow: you'll have strong communication skills and background working directly with teams, users and stakeholders, as well as experience working with vendors and partners to resolve bigger outages and manage upgrades and improvements. You don't need development experience but a good technical understanding of the applications is important.
The right person will have hands-on administration experience in at least one of the core platforms, a working knowledge of ITIL service management principles, and the organisational ability to manage multiple workstreams without dropping things.
The role will pay around £45-55K base; you'll need to be in the office in central Glasgow 2/3 days a week.
